NJ Environmental Federation's interns are actively involved in all areas of the organization, and play a vital role in the day-to-day operations. We are seeking interns who are well-organized team players with a commitment to and interest in environmental policy/eduction, non-profits, and/or marketing/communications. Interning with NJ Environmental Federation is a great way to gain real world experience that could lead to a career in non-profit management, environmental affairs, communications, marketing, or many other avenues.
The marketing/communications intern will work closely with NJ Environmental Federation's Communications Coordinator on website content management, newsletters, blogs, media outreach, and marketing materials. Additionally, the marketing/communications intern will have the opportunity to work on projects involving video editing, marketing design, and strategic planning, allowing for valuable experience in the field of environmental protection and communications and marketing.
